As our shops fill with Halloween décor, I am reminded of my childhood in Scotland. Halloween is the shortened form of All Hallows Eve, and as this occurs on the eve of the Feast of All Saints we believed that this was a time when the spirits were not at rest until the power of all the saints brought peace on the 1st November. As part of this tradition, we would light a candle as a sign of light and love to those who need to be guided home.
